St Philip's Sunday School, for students age 4 through grade 12, provides a broad-ranging education in Orthodox faith and life. Through the use of Scripture, prayers, hymns, and icons, children learn about their Faith and the life of the Church - its Scriptures, Services, Sacraments, Feasts, and Saints.

Teen SOYO, for students in grades 9-12, meets following the Liturgy every Sunday. In addition to their Christian studies at that time, service and outreach activities enable them to increase their love for God and neighbor, and social activities give them the opportunity to develop relationships to last a lifetime.
